Mary McClung
Director of Costuming
Visiting Associate Professor of Costume Design
MFA - Theatre Design, West Virginia University
BFA - Art & Design, Alfred University
Professor McClung has designed costumes, puppets, and sets for clients
such as Disney, Children’s Television Workshop, Universal Studios,
Dallas Children’s Theatre, and The Colorado Shakespeare Festival.
Design credits include: The Tempest, A Midsummer Night’s Dream, The
Life of Insects, The Beggar’s Opera, Henry IV part I and II, Great God
Brown, The Seagull, Three Sisters, Sesamo Barrio (Sesame Street, Spain),
The Long Christmas Ride Home, The Big Friendly Giant, and Tartuffe.
McClung has also taught Theatre Design at The University of Dallas,
(Dallas, Texas) and Whitman College, (Walla Walla, Washington) where she
also worked as a guest designer. McClung was awarded The 2002 Dallas
Critic’s Award for Costume Design of The Beggar’s Opera.
